Side-by-side financial comparison of CROSS COUNTRY HEALTHCARE INC (CCRN) and Jefferson Capital, Inc. (JCAP). Click either name above to swap in a different company.

CROSS COUNTRY HEALTHCARE INC is the larger business by last-quarter revenue ($236.8M vs $150.8M, roughly 1.6× Jefferson Capital, Inc.). Jefferson Capital, Inc. runs the higher net margin — 25.4% vs -35.0%, a 60.5% gap on every dollar of revenue. Jefferson Capital, Inc. produced more free cash flow last quarter ($63.0M vs $16.1M).

GE Capital was the financial services division of General Electric. Its various units were sold between 2013 and 2021, including the notable spin-off of the North American consumer finance division as Synchrony Financial. Ultimately, only one division of the company remained, GE Energy Financial Services, which was transferred to GE Vernova when General Electric was broken up.
